Day 17

To notice when I say things to myself that make me feel bad, and find ways of thinking of things that make me feel better.

 

Hmm…Is it soft or wimpy to speak nicely to yourself?  No!  It is responsible, compassionate and effective if you want to be your happiest and get the best performance from yourself. 

Frankly, some things we say to ourselves are downright abusive, and we would never say them to another person (at least if we were at all on good behavior!) 

Here are some examples of things you might say to yourself that aren’t helpful, and how they can be adjusted so that you are not lying to yourself, but you are not being mean either. 

 

Not so nice:  I am an idiot!

Better:  That wasn’t so smart of me…

Better yet: I am not sure I approached that in the best way…how could I do this better next time?

 

Not so nice:  I’ll never be good at anything!

Better:  I might need more practice at this.

Better yet:  I know I have talents; I just need to figure out what they are.

 

Get the idea?  Sometimes you will need to try out a couple of things on yourself, and see how they feel, until you find something that works better for you (i.e. feels better to you.) 

Even if you are skeptical, or proud of your rough and tumble internal environment (nothing hurts you, hmm?  Sure!), I hope you at least give this a chance.  This is about building yourself up to be the best person you can be, instead of tearing yourself down. 

Today’s Intention: 

Today I intend to notice when I say things to myself that make me feel bad, and find ways of thinking of things that make me feel better.
